Its strategy is to consolidate its position as a gold\nproducer in Africa and build itself into a highly profitable mid-tier\ngold company, leveraged through revenue generated from its gold\nrecovery businesses.\n\nThe Company has two recovery businesses based in South Africa and\nGhana, which, by safely disposing mining by-products, fulfil an\nimportant aspect of the mines' environmental management programmes.\nThe South African plant is located near the centre of the East Rand\nGoldfield and raw material feedstocks are sourced from many of the\nmajor South African mining companies, including AngloGold Ashanti,\nGoldfields, Harmony, DRD Gold and other smaller producers. The Ghana\nplant, located in the free port of Tema, provides access to raw\nmaterials from mines in Mali, Guinea, Burkina Faso, Benin, Cote\nD'Ivorie, Senegal, the DRC and Mauritania, as well as Ghana.\n\nGoldplat's strategy is to build itself into a highly profitable\nmid-tier gold producer, through the acquisition of known deposits\nwith targets of between 200,000 and one million contained ounces.
